New Chief Legal Counsellor at the Riksbank

The Executive Board of the Riksbank today appointed Per Håkansson the new Chief Legal Cousellor, located in the bank's Secretariat of the Executive Board, with effect from 1 October 2002. The Chief Legal Counsellor reports to the Executive Board on legal issues and drafts these issues together with the Governor.

Per Håkansson has worked at the Riksbank as advisor to the Executive Board since 2001 and is at present employed in the Financial Stability Department. He has previously been assessor at the Svea Court of Appeal and worked in the financial market department at the Ministry of Finance. His most recent post prior to joining the Riksbank was at Sweden's permanent delegation at the EU.

Prior to the appointment of a new head of department for the Secretariat of the Executive Board, see also the press release issued on 4 July 2002, the Riksbank decided to also appoint a new Chief Legal Counsellor. The former holder of this post, Robert Sparve, has taken up an appointment at the International Monetary Fund (IMF) in Washington.

The Secretariat of the Executive Board provides administrative support to the Executive Board and the General Council, as well as giving legal and other advice to the management of the Riksbank and the various departments within the bank.
